ZKX's LAB

在编程语言越来越高级的情况下,程序员学习汇编有什么意义? 花指令影响反汇编原理

2021-03-27知识2

汇编(编译原理)中的mov指令和一般程序代码中的意思是反。 汇编(编译原理)中的mov指令和一般程序代码中的意思是反.听错了。6.送你一朵玫瑰花,传情达意全靠它,送你一朵大桃花,时来运转有赖它,送你一碗豆腐花,要你一天到晚笑哈哈!

为什么破坏性超强的病毒都是C语言写的,有没有用易语言写的破坏性超强的有名的病毒

我想写个反汇编算法,用的是C/C++ 我有我发头文件给你发你邮件了.很好用只要给个地址他返回这条指令的全部信息.直接查表模式速度N块的.

如何学习逆向工程?作为过来人,有什么可以嘱咐晚辈的? 如题,逆向工程最近在学习,希望能收到一些建议以下是原题主描述我一直觉得开发外挂很牛逼的样子,听说这…

怎样学会单片机? 1.怎样动手从头开始?2.怎样理解晶振/中断/存储器等?3.怎样记住单片机汇编指令?4.怎样看…

安卓加密方法都有哪些? 安卓加密方法都有哪些,安卓加密是指对安卓应用的APK进行加密加固,以防止他人进行反编译,逆向分析,获取源码,注入广告代码,恶意代码,再进行二次打包。。

给文件加壳,加花,去壳,分别是什么意思?

关于加密的和反汇编的 1)如果加密的时候,假设明文有256个数据,然后我每个数据的密钥各不相同,但算法相同,比如x1=key1*100;x2=key2*100;xn=keyn*100;那这样不是破解一个月都。

花指令的花指令生成器 一、写花指令生成器必备知识1、花指令原理花指令是程序中的无用代码,程序对它没影响,少了它也能正常运行。加花指令后,杀毒软件对木马静态反汇编时,木马的代码就不会正常显示出来,加大杀毒软件的查杀难度。2、如何写花指令下面我们先看看一段花指令,分析理解它的原理:PUSH EBPMOV EBP,ESPpush edxpop edxinc ecxdec ecxadd esp,21add esp,-21add esp,10sub esp,10JMP 附近空地址随便乱跳JMP 原入口点花指令一般有三部分,开头就是PUSH EBP和MOV EBP,ESP这两句在大部分程序开头可以经常看到。PUSH EBP是把EBP压入堆栈,MOV EBP,ESP是把ESP的值赋给EBP,不懂没关系,只要知道PUSH EBP和MOV EBP,ESP这两句经常出现在文件开头就可以了,随便用OllyDbg打开一个不加壳的文件载入后经常停在PUSH EBP MOV EBP,ESP。接下来就是花指令啦,push edx是把通用寄存器EDX压入堆栈,pop edx是把通用寄存器EDX弹出堆栈,这两句和起来就相当于什么也没做。接下来的inc ecx,ecx用来保存计数值,也是寄存器,INC是加1;下面的dec ecx中的dec是减1,加1减1相抵消,又是什么也没做。add esp,21这是寄存器esp加21,add是加上,下面一句add esp,-21是寄存器esp加-21。

#花指令影响反汇编原理#反汇编指令#stm32反汇编指令详解

随机阅读

qrcode
访问手机版